Trivia factoid on xcl - early in the days of canadian television there was a programme called Front Page Challenge, they would have guests involved in topical news stories, known to the audience and viewers but not to the panel of four pundits, hidden behind a screen .... the four, all quite bright and articulate, would ask questions in an attempt to identify the guest and the news story ... and they would crack jokes and let slip a great deal of relevant juicy detail on canadian politics, stuff you wouldn't get from a newspaper, and very entertaining, FPC ran for many years .... one panelist was a lady named Betty Kennedy, smart as a whip yet quite lady-like about it, this was the fifties of course ... she later married another on the panel, big canadian author Pierre Berton ... also she is currently a senator ... anyway, you don't find much higher society in this country, and she's the mother of Shawn Kennedy, president of X-Cal .... which has likely aided him in making connections [there are many europeans holding the stock], but at the same time he is a practical man, is proficient with a chainsaw, and can fix his own, that i respect

Not everyone is impressed at times with his homegrown style of promotion, a system in which the westcoast promo houses don't get fed cheap shares and warrants at regular PP intervals to motivate them to push the shareprice for long enough for them to dump their own .... notice that he has not done any major financings yet this year, a small one only on 24 May, 1.5m at .45 with half-warrants at .60 ... he needs five millions or more to advance Sleeper significantly, he will accept only terms he views as favourable, will he get them sooner or later, this is the question ... fairly soon i think, but you never know .... the Gata people have picked up on xcl, hard to say if this is asset or liability because they came on in such a rush a few weeks ago and made it spike up weak, but if they or others can do that again more convincingly, and it aids SK in getting off say five millions shares at a loonie apiece, then look out above - the chances of pulling bonanza grade core at Sleeper within the first few dozen drill holes are quite good .... there is already a considerable resource developed, not quite ready for TSE standards of measured and indicated, but not that far away either .... at this point it's a matter of financing, how much, on what terms, and when .... lots on decent terms relatively soon i think maybe, it would sure help if the PoG would hurry up with its next test of the 330 level
